DTF transfers on t-shirts: From design to durable wear

DTF transfers on t-shirts open a wide range of creative possibilities. Start with high-resolution artwork (300 dpi or higher) and save in a format that preserves color fidelity, such as PNG with a transparent background for non-rectangular designs. Mirroring the image may be required depending on your printer or workflow, and it’s important to plan for edge bleed and alignment to keep details sharp on curved seams.

To apply DTF transfers on t-shirts, assemble the essential gear: DTF transfer film, hot-melt adhesive powder, a heat press with adjustable temperature and timer, protective sheets like a Teflon cover, and a clean, pre-washed garment. Position the transfer using a ruler for precise centering, pre-press to remove moisture and flatten fibers, then apply heat at the recommended temperature and dwell time. If you’re looking for how to apply DTF transfers correctly, follow the film manufacturer’s guidance on peeling (warm or cold) and whether a top layer is needed for total opacity.

DTF printing process: Master heat, timing, and post-press care

DTF printing process is at the heart of reliable results. It begins with artwork prepared for transfer, color management, and proper mirroring if required by your workflow. The choice of film, backing, and adhesive affects adhesion, durability through washing, and opacity on dark fabrics. Start with heat-press settings for DTF that match your fabric type; common starting points are around 170–185°C (338–365°F) for 12–20 seconds with medium to firm pressure, then adjust based on film and garment.

Post-press care and troubleshooting DTF transfers keep designs looking fresh. If you encounter ghosting, edge peeling, or bubbling, re-check temperature, time, and pressure, then re-press as needed following the film’s directions. For those learning how to apply DTF transfers in practice, always perform a final cure and wash test after 24 hours, turn garments inside-out for washing, and use mild detergents. Document your settings for different fabrics to reproduce consistent results in future runs.

How do I apply DTF transfers on t-shirts using the DTF printing process, and what heat press settings for DTF should I start with?

To apply DTF transfers on t-shirts, start with a clean, pre-washed garment and pre-press to remove moisture. Mirror the design if required, trim the transfer, and place the film side down on the fabric. In the heat press, aim for 170–185°C (338–365°F) for 12–20 seconds with medium to firm pressure, then allow a brief set before peeling (warm or cold as directed by the film). Use a Teflon sheet to protect the surface, and finish with a light post-press if recommended by the film manufacturer. Proper curing and care will maximize durability and color fidelity across cotton, blends, and other fabrics.

What are common issues when troubleshooting DTF transfers, and how can I fix them during the application process?

Common issues include ghosting or incomplete transfers, edges peeling, bubbling, or color fade after washing. To fix them, verify even pressure and correct temperature and time per your DTF transfer film, ensure the transfer is properly trimmed and aligned, and re-press with a protective sheet if needed. Make sure the garment is fully dry and pre-pressed, and avoid over-stretching the fabric. If peeling persists, try a slightly higher dwell time, ensure you are using the recommended backing, and perform a test run on a scrap garment.

Step 1: Materials & Planning
  • Printer capable of printing on DTF transfer film with compatible ink (or use a service providing pre‑made DTF transfers).
  • DTF transfer film sheets and hot‑melt adhesive powder.
  • Heat press with adjustable temperature and timer; protective sheet (teflon or silicone).
  • Clean, preferably pre‑washed, dry garment.
  • Scissors/cutting tool and lint roller or tape to prepare the transfer.
  • Ruler/alignment aid and protective gear (gloves, silicone mat).
  • Design prepared at high resolution (usually 300 dpi) in a color‑preserving format (PNG with transparent background for non‑rectangular designs).
Step 2: Design & Print
  • Artwork should be clean, high‑res, and mirrored if required by workflow.
  • Print at 300 dpi or higher; save as PNG/TIFF to preserve sharp edges.
  • Mirror the image if needed; verify color accuracy against expected print using printer profile.
  • Trim transfer film to design size with a small margin to prevent edge bleed.
Step 3: Garment & Workspace Prep
  • Pre‑wash and dry garment to remove sizing and fibers that affect adhesion.
  • Pre‑press briefly to remove moisture and flatten wrinkles.
  • Position garment taut on the platen; use a press pad/silicone mat for protection.
  • Place a protective sheet over the garment.
  • Longer pre‑press may help on dark fabrics to reduce moisture pockets.
Step 4: Position & Secure
  • Place trimmed film face‑down where design should appear.
  • Check centering with a ruler; ensure symmetry with sleeves/seams.
  • Lightly press edges to hold in place, then cover with protective sheet.
Step 5: Apply with Heat Press
  • Typical ranges: 170–185°C (338–365°F); 12–20 seconds depending on film/fabric.
  • Use medium–firm pressure; avoid excessive pressure that causes ghosting.
  • Post‑press: let adhesive set briefly before peeling; peeling can be warm or cold per film guidance.
  • Warm‑peel is common; cold peel used when required by film.
Step 6: Post‑press Care
  • Cool briefly, remove protective sheet, inspect for incomplete areas.
  • Second light press if needed with protective sheet.
  • Wait at least 24 hours before washing to cure.
  • Washing: inside‑out, cold/warm water, avoid harsh detergents/fabric softeners.
Step 7: Troubleshooting
  • Ghosting/incomplete transfer: ensure even pressure, correct temp/time; adjust dwell or temp as needed.
  • Peeling at edges: re‑press with protective sheet; trim transfer close to edges.
  • Cracking/creasing: ensure flat garment and non‑overstretched transfer; re‑press if needed.
  • Bubbling/wrinkles: pre‑press to remove moisture; verify alignment; re‑press if necessary.
  • Fading: check film compatibility and curing time; test swatches for revision.
Step 8: Fabric Tips & Advanced
  • 100% cotton: strong adhesion and colors; higher heat/time may help.
  • Poly blends: moderate temps and careful pressure; test first.
  • Dark fabrics: use film designed for dark fabrics or use white underlay; adjust opacity.
  • Light fabrics: shorter dwell time and lighter pressure.
  • Practice on swatches to refine settings by fabric and film.
